Key Insights of Japan DMSO-free Freezing Culture Media Market

  • Market size estimated at approximately $150 million in 2024, with a projected CAGR of 12.5% through 2033.
  • Major growth fueled by rising demand for cell therapy, regenerative medicine, and personalized medicine applications.
  • Leading segment: Stem cell preservation, accounting for over 45% of total market share, driven by clinical and research needs.
  • Primary application focus: Cryopreservation of pluripotent stem cells and immune cells, with increasing adoption in biobanking and therapeutic manufacturing.
  • Dominant geographical share: Japan’s biotech hubs (Tokyo, Osaka) hold over 60% of market activity, supported by local innovation clusters and regulatory incentives.
  • Key market opportunity: Development of next-generation, biocompatible, and scalable DMSO-free media tailored for large-volume bioprocessing.
  • Major players include global biotech firms expanding R&D in Japan, alongside innovative local startups focusing on proprietary formulations.

Market Dynamics of Japan DMSO-Free Freezing Culture Media

The Japan DMSO-free freezing culture media industry is characterized by rapid technological evolution, driven by stringent safety regulations and rising clinical adoption. The market is transitioning from early-stage research to commercial-scale deployment, with a focus on optimizing cell viability, scalability, and cost-effectiveness. Regulatory frameworks in Japan favor the adoption of DMSO-free solutions due to safety concerns associated with traditional cryoprotectants, creating a conducive environment for innovation.

Market growth is further supported by government initiatives promoting regenerative medicine and cell therapy, which require advanced cryopreservation techniques. The competitive landscape is intensifying as global biotech companies establish local R&D centers, while startups innovate with novel formulations. Supply chain resilience and strategic partnerships are critical to meeting the increasing demand for high-quality, compliant media. Overall, the industry is poised for sustained growth, with technological advancements and regulatory support acting as key catalysts.
